Details

After being picked up from your hotel, head to a scenic coastal town on Sagami Bay, connected to the mainland by a bridge. Explore Enoshima Shrine and take in sweeping views from the Sea Candle lighthouse and observation deck (entry fee not included), then sample local street food and cafes (at your own expense). Continue to Kōtoku-in Temple, home to the 13-meter Great Buddha, with an optional stroll to Hase-dera Temple, known for its hydrangeas and city views.

Next, head to Yokahama, where a traditional shopping street offers local eats, souvenirs, and snack shops, making it a perfect lunch stop with soba or udon restaurants. The journey continues to Japan’s largest Chinatown, featuring more than 600 shops, the colorful Kanteibyo Temple, and endless street food and desserts. End at the historic warehouse district, now a trendy cultural hub with shopping, harbor views, and photo-worthy backdrops.
